Предмет: Информатика,
автор: светулька3454
решить задачи в Python: 1) в числе найдите минимальную нечетную цифру.
2) найдите все четырехзначные числа, сумма каждого из которых равна 10.
3) дан массив целых чисел. проверить есть ли в нем одинаковые элементы.
Ответы
Автор ответа:
0
Ответ:
#1
print(min( list( filter(lambda p: p % 2 != 0, [int(i) for i in list(input())]) ) ))
#2
[print(number) for number in range(1000, 9999+1) if sum([int(i) for i in list(str(number))]) == 10]
#3
import random
lst = [random.randint(-99, 99) for i in range(random.randint(10, 25))]
print('Все элементы разные' if (len(lst) == len(set(lst))) else 'Есть повторяющиеся элементы' )
Протестировано
Похожие вопросы
Предмет: Английский язык,
автор: Extrime
Предмет: Английский язык,
автор: kina10
Предмет: Русский язык,
автор: GirlishYULIA
Предмет: Биология,
автор: милая1234